Electrons move at high speeds around the nucleus of an atom. The electrons move in specific energy levels or shells, each with a different distance from the nucleus. This movement is what helps to define the chemical properties of the element.

The blur of electrons around the nucleus of an atom is typically referred to as an electron cloud or electron orbital. These terms are used to describe the region where electrons are most likely to be found in relation to the nucleus.
The cloud around an atom's nucleus is called an electron cloud. An electromagnetic force binds electrons inside an electrostatic potential well, which surrounds the nucleus.
